two (2) flashlights (one in my pocket + one on my keychain), keys, multi-tool, knife, whistle, paracord bracelet, lighter, pepper spray

Of all the items I carry, the only thing that I really consider a weapon is the pepper spray.  Everything else is a tool, though some of the items could see use in a self-defense situation.  Besides, the best self-defense tool, in my opinion, is your brain, and the best techniques are awareness and avoidance – be aware of your surroundings, and avoid potentially dangerous situations.  This train of thought, however, is best reserved for another post (or even another site), so that’s all I’ll say about self-defense.

Getting back on topic, the items I carry are tools that help me tackle everyday emergencies or other situations.  Like I said, I’m a scout, and I like to be prepared.  There’s a saying that “it’s better to have it and not need it, than to need it and not have it.”  For a lot of everyday urban situations, I’m probably covered.

That being said, I still want to add a few things to this kit.  I still want to add a Gerber Shard or some other pry-bar, as well as some form of ID that lists my blood type, allergies, emergency contact, and other information.  Heck, I’ve got a whole list of items I want on Amazon (and since it’s a wish list that other people can see, I’ve limited it to items under $100).
